# Building Access: Holiday Opening Hours

During the winter shutdown (24 Dec–2 Jan), Tarnwick Plaza runs reduced hours. The main entrance is open 09:00–15:00 weekdays only; weekends the building is fully closed. Reception is unstaffed, so all entry is via the east door badge reader. Heating runs on a skeleton schedule — bring a jumper. Deliveries are suspended; couriers will be turned away. New starters without an activated badge should use the temporary door code below.

turnstile pass: bdg-R-53

Hi Verena,

The Lanternfell admin dashboard cut-over finished last night without rollback. All legacy stylesheet tokens were replaced with the new theme variables, and the contrast audit passed on every panel except the archived-reports view, which we've flagged for a follow-up patch. Session persistence of the user's theme choice now lives server-side, so please double-check the cookie fallback logic during review. For reference while you read the diff, the production theming configuration we deployed is as follows.

deployment values, fahap-hahaf:
[casdor]
port = 9200
region = south-2
host = casdor.qirvanworks.corp
timeout_ms = 3000
retries = 4

## Runbook: Cursor pagination rollout — Tidegate API

This release switches the public `/v2/listings` endpoint from offset to cursor pagination. Offset params still work behind the `legacy_page` flag until next quarter. Watch for 400s from clients sending both `page` and `cursor` — that's expected, don't roll back for it. Canary on two nodes first, hold 20 minutes, then fleet-wide. The canary deploy script verifies artifacts against our release key, pasted below for reference.

signing key of bagap-yawep = bky13_TbfT6ZMUoGJo2